Students who need help with the cost of textbooks may be interested in a Parent’s Association loan program.   Bucks for Books provides loans of up to $500 for books to any currently enrolled student.  Loans repaid by the end of the trimester accrue no interest.   

    

The program is only valid for use at the RHIT bookstore.  For more information, contact Melinda Middleton or Luann Hastings in Student Financial Aid. 

    

 

     JP Morgan Chase purchasing cards are being issued to campus buyers.  Staff and faculty are finding it easier to manage their campus buying as the result of the new program.

     These ‘P’ cards are intended to replace check requests and purchase orders where appropriate. 

     Policies in the current Purchasing Guide must still be followed; card purchases must be less than $2500 and cannot include prohibited items such as lab animals or controlled substances, nor be used for cash advances or travel expenses.  At the end

of every budget month, departments approve purchases and submit receipts to the Business Office. 

    

 

 

 

 

     The ADS website contains additional information in the Cardholder Guide. 

     Direct questions to Bob Watson or Dan Wells, in Administrative Services.

     The past several months have seen a number of changes in ADS.  Matt McNichols, Art Curator, and his part-time assistant, Erin Goldstein have left their positions at RHIT.  

     We would like to welcome the new Director of Arts Programming and Curator, Steve Letsinger, x8452.  Steve will continue to teach in addition to his new duties overseeing the RHIT art collection.  This position now reports to Caroline Carvill in the HSS department.   Other changes in ADS:New

packaging-tracking software in the Mail Distribution Center

· Two new pieces of equipment in the Mail Processing Center 

· Plastic spiral binding has been added in the Print and Copy Center

· Student insurance waivers are now completed online

· Purchasing cards have been rolled out to staff and faculty
